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History?

The cheapest way to get from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History is to bus via Radcliffe Observatory Quarter which costs $1.52 - $2.17 and takes 15 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History?

The fastest way to get from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History is to taxi which takes 5 min and costs $15.22 - $19.57 .

Is there a direct bus between Oxford Station and Oxford University Museum of Natural History?

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Frideswide Square and arriving at Radcliffe Observatory Quarter.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 8 min.

How far is it from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History?

The distance between Oxford Station and Oxford University Museum of Natural History is 2 km.

How do I travel from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History without a car?

The best way to get from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History without a car is to bus via Radcliffe Observatory Quarter which takes 15 min and costs $1.52 - $2.17 .

How long does it take to get from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History?

The bus from Frideswide Square to Radcliffe Observatory Quarter takes 8 min including transfers and departs every 20 minutes.

Where do I catch the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History bus from?

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, depart from Frideswide Square station.

Where does the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History bus arrive?

Oxford Station to Oxford University Museum of Natural History b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, arrive at Radcliffe Observatory Quarter station.
